Why Miramar Homes Need Regular Duct Cleaning
Miramar's subtropical climate creates unique challenges for HVAC systems. With humidity levels often exceeding 70% and temperatures requiring AC operation 8-10 months per year, your ductwork accumulates moisture, dust, and organic matter that can harbor mold and bacteria. The city's proximity to the Everglades also means increased pollen and outdoor allergens entering your home. Construction activity throughout Broward County adds fine particulates that settle in ducts. Most Miramar homes benefit from professional duct cleaning every 3-5 years, though homes with pets, smokers, or family members with allergies may need service every 2-3 years. Signs your ducts need attention include visible dust buildup around vents, musty odors when the AC runs, frequent respiratory issues among family members, or unexplained increases in your energy bills.
The Professional Duct Cleaning Process
Professional duct cleaning in Miramar involves a comprehensive multi-step process using specialized equipment designed for Florida's climate challenges. Certified technicians begin with a thorough inspection using video cameras to assess contamination levels and identify any structural issues. The cleaning process uses powerful truck-mounted vacuum systems generating 3,000+ CFM airflow, combined with rotating brushes and compressed air tools to dislodge debris from duct walls. All supply and return vents are sealed during cleaning to maintain proper negative pressure throughout the system. The process typically takes 3-5 hours for average Miramar homes (1,500-2,500 sq ft) and includes cleaning of the main trunk lines, branch ducts, registers, grilles, and air handler components. Professional services also sanitize the system with EPA-approved antimicrobials specifically formulated for Florida's humid conditions.
Cost and Energy Savings in Miramar
Professional duct cleaning in Miramar typically costs between $300-$800 for most residential properties, depending on home size, ductwork complexity, and contamination level. While this represents an upfront investment, the energy savings can be substantial in Florida's climate. Clean ducts can improve HVAC efficiency by 10-15%, which translates to $200-$500 annual savings on your FPL or Duke Energy bills for average Miramar homes. The EPA estimates that removing just 0.042 inches of dust buildup from cooling coils can improve efficiency by up to 21%. Additional benefits include extended HVAC equipment life (potentially saving $5,000-$15,000 in premature replacement costs), improved indoor air quality, and reduced allergy medications and healthcare costs for sensitive family members.
Choosing the Right Duct Cleaning Service
When selecting a duct cleaning service in Miramar, verify the company holds proper licensing through the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ation and maintains liability insurance. Look for NADCA (National Air Duct Cleaners Association) certification, which ensures adherence to industry standards. Reputable companies provide detailed written estimates, explain their cleaning process, and offer before-and-after video documentation. Be wary of door-to-door solicitors or extremely low-priced offers under $200, which often indicate inadequate equipment or upselling tactics. Quality services use truck-mounted equipment, not portable units, and should clean the entire HVAC system including the air handler, coils, and drain pan. Ask about their sanitization process and whether they're experienced with Florida's specific mold and humidity challenges.
Maintaining Clean Ducts in Miramar's Climate
Between professional cleanings, Miramar homeowners can maintain cleaner ductwork through proper HVAC maintenance and household practices. Replace your air filter every 30-60 days during peak cooling season using MERV 8-11 filters that balance filtration with airflow. Keep your home's humidity below 50% using your AC's dehumidification mode or supplemental dehumidifiers. Seal any duct leaks promptly—common in Florida homes due to settling and temperature fluctuations. Regular professional HVAC maintenance every 6 months helps identify potential issues before they affect duct cleanliness. Keep vents unobstructed by furniture, and consider upgrading to HEPA-filtered air purifiers in bedrooms or common areas. During Broward County's dry season (November-April), increased dust infiltration may require more frequent filter changes.

Is duct cleaning covered by homeowners insurance?
Standard homeowners insurance typically doesn't cover routine duct cleaning. However, if contamination results from a covered event like water damage or fire, cleanup may be included. Check with your insurance provider about specific coverage details.

Should I clean ducts before or after hurricane season?
Ideally, schedule duct cleaning before hurricane season (May-November) to ensure optimal air quality during extended indoor periods. However, post-storm cleaning may be necessary if flooding or debris infiltration occurs during severe weather events.
